Question : Directions: Two horses A and B run at a speed of 3:2 ratio in the first lap, during the second lap the ratio differs by 4:7, and during the third lap their ratio differs by 8:9. What is the difference in the ratio of speed altogether between the two horses?
Option 1: 4
Option 2: 2
Option 3: 3
Option 4: 1
Correct Answer: 1
Solution : Given: Two horses A and B run at a speed of 3:2 ratio in the first lap, during the second lap their ratio differs by 4:7, and during the third lap, their ratio differs by 8:9.
Let us consider that the common factor for multiplication for the ratio speeds is x. So, speeds achieved by A and B during the first, second and third laps are 3x, 4x, 8x and 2x, 7x, 9x Avg speed achieved by A = (3x + 4x + 8x) ÷ 3= 15x ÷ 3 = 5x Avg speed achieved by B = (2x + 7x + 9x) ÷ 3 = 18x ÷ 3 = 6x Ratio of avg speeds of A and B = 5x : 6x = 5 : 6 The difference between the ratio of speeds altogether = 6 – 5 = 1
Therefore, the required difference is 1. Hence, the fourth option is correct.
